Light-weight concrete is made using light-weight aggregates, such as pumice, clay, or perlite. Given that the particular accumulations picked are what establishes the density of the concrete, light-weight concrete is reduced in thickness, and also is defined as any type of kind of concrete with a thickness degree of much less than 1920kg/m3. Lightweight concrete is used in locations where the total amount "dead weight" of a building can be decreased to help protect against collapse, such as walls or flooring.

Polymer concrete is concrete in which the lime as well as shale-based Portland cement is replaced with a polymer binder that remedies and hardens, such as a polyester, epoxy mixes, plastic ester, acrylics, or many numerous kinds of polymer resins.

Epoxy binders, for instance, will help in much less contraction during treating while acrylic binders supply weather resistance as well as quicker setting times. Polymer plastic is stickier than concrete, as well as consequently, when incorporated in a concrete mix, leads to a concrete of higher tensile strength than one composed of Portland cement. When mixing with each other a polymer binder with water as well as aggregates, a chemical reaction occurs that begins the treating procedure quicker than regular concrete.

Reinforced concrete, additionally called reinforced cement concrete, is made with strengthened bars, generally rebar, to enhance the tensile toughness of the concrete.

Specialists may come across reinforced concrete in large structures that require a tremendous amount of tensile strength, such as tall buildings, bridges, dams, or any type of construction scenario that entails a framework needing to bring exceptionally heavy tons. Pervious concrete is a more porous sort of concrete that lets water go through it to groundwater beneath.

There are little to no fine accumulations in this type of concrete, developing even more gaps for water as well as air to pass through. This allows stormwater to be infiltrated the concrete and also travel through into the ground. Pervious concrete can help protect against flooding given that the water that would normally move through storm drains is absorbed by the earth.

High stamina concrete is any concrete that has a compressive strength of 6000 extra pounds per square inch (PSI) or greater. It is used strong, long lasting accumulations and has a high cement content as well as lower water to cement proportion, with superplasticizers contributed to improve any workability issues stemming from stickier concrete.

High-strength concrete is typically used in the building of skyscrapers servicing extremely compressive tons. Quick set concrete is a kind of concrete that sets at a quicker speed than typical concrete, normally within one to a decorative concrete patio contractor number of hrs contrasted to the common 2 days.

Quick collection concrete comes premixed and also prepares to make use of, which is why It is generally made use of for non-structural concrete jobs, such as concrete fixing and repair. Self-compacting concrete, or self-consolidating concrete, is a kind of concrete with 3 key homes: a high filling capacity, allowing it to flow effortlessly throughout the formwork when put, as distributed by its very own weight; a high passing away ability allowing it to circulate any type of restricted spaces as well as blockages like steel reinforcement; and segregation resistance, or staying the very same state, throughout transportation, putting, as well as after putting.
